What Glycerin Suppositories Actually Do
Glycerin suppositories work by drawing water into the stool, which softens it and makes passage easier. Unlike stimulant laxatives that trigger muscle contractions in your intestines, glycerin takes a gentler approach. This matters if you have a sensitive stomach, experience bloating easily, or want to avoid cramping. The suppository delivers its action directly to the lower colon, meaning it works locally rather than affecting your entire digestive system.
Most people experience relief within 15 minutes to an hour of use. This relatively quick timeline makes suppositories practical when you need help but don't want to wait through your entire day.

When Suppositories Aren't the Right Answer
If you have chronic constipation that happens several times a week or more, suppositories work better as part of a broader approach including dietary changes and possibly other treatments. They're designed for occasional use, not daily management of persistent issues. Chronic constipation warrants a conversation with your doctor about underlying causes.
Also consider your comfort level with the administration method itself. Suppositories require some personal comfort with insertion. If this doesn't suit you, oral laxatives remain a solid alternative worth discussing with a pharmacist.
